The Opportunity

An exciting opportunity exists within Division of Paediatric Medicine to join us as a Nurse Educatorin theMichael Rice Centre for Haematology Oncology.

Role Responsibilities:

  • Providing education and training support to the nursing staff within the Michael Rice Centre for Haematology Oncology. 
  • Coordination and leadership of projects, programs and/or research to achieve improved educational outcomes and/or service delivery.
  • Integrate contemporary evidence, personal experience, and expert clinical knowledge to inform decision-making, foster innovation, and optimise nursing practice.
  • Contribute to competency improvement and analysis, measurement and evaluation of education and professional development.
  • Plan, coordinate and provide education support for change processes, risk management practices and service improvement activities within the organisation’s professional practice, education and administrative frameworks.

About You

To be successful in this role, you will have:

  • Registered or eligible for registration as a Nurse with the Nursing and Midwifery Board of Australia and who holds, or who is eligible to hold, a current practicing certificate
  • Registered Nurse with at least 3 years post registration experience.
  • The ability to prepare and deliver high-quality presentations in various educational settings for both community and professional audiences.
  • The ability to develop, coordinate, and deliver education programs while conducting evaluations to ensure effectiveness.
  • Effective leadership skills including advanced communication, problem-solving, conflict resolution, and negotiation.
  • The proven ability to perform effectively under pressure, prioritize workloads, and demonstrate resilience.

Demonstrated experience and skills in nursing/midwifery education or staff development.
